#2b773e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b773e is composed of 16.9% red, 46.7%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.9%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 135 degrees, a saturation of 46.9% and a lightness of 31.8%. #2b773e color hex could be obtained by blending #56ee7c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#2b773e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010402 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b773e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505251 is the less saturated color, while #069c2b is the most saturated one.
